NEW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

38 of the 5,696 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Puxin Limited American Depositary Shares, each representing twenty Ordinary Shares (NEW)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$41.1M — down 8.1% from $44.7M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 15 funds opened new NEW posit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 13 holders — while 9 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.

The largest buyer was HSBC Holdings, opening a new position worth an estimated $3.33M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$3.15M.
